Modified My Joe Rocket Tank Bag

I recently bought a Joe Rocket Tank Bag and decided to modify the top pocket with the window. I use my smartphone as a GPS so why not make this pocket useful for when I dont know where Im going. I cut the top off and hand sewed a clear vinyl with nylon string. The phone in the picture is the Galaxy S3 so its a big phone. Very happy on how it turned out.

I modified my Rapid Transit Recon 19 tank bag also...mine had a phone pocket w the clear vinyl already but it was too small for a Droid Incredible 2.
So I cut it a bit, then redid the stitching so it now fits my phone.

I then ran into the problem of overheating, first I just kept the phone zipper open some... well 1 day it wasn't closed enough and 1 big bump and my phone flew out @ 80+... So my solution was to cut holes in the top and bottom of where phone sits. This forces air through the pocket and keeps the phone quite cool, while it is fully zippered closed.
